Incident hand OA is strongly associated with reduced peripheral blood leukocyte telomere length

Abstract
ObjectiveTo evaluate the relationship of telomere length to the prevalence and incidence of hand osteoarthritis in a longitudinal cohort.DesignWe conducted a cross-sectional and longitudinal analysis of data from a subset of participants in the Osteoarthritis Initiative (OAI) recruited between February 2004 and May 2006. 274 individuals were eligible for the study based on availability of both baseline and 48-month hand radiographs and...
